Amada HFT 100-3 Specifications
| Strength | 100 T |
|---|---|
| Folding length | 3150 mm |
| Distance between uprights | 2705 mm |
| Throat | 400 mm |
| Vertical stroke | 350 mm |
| Working speed | 71 mm/s |
| Axis number | 4 |
| Engine Power | 11.18568 kW |
| Length x width x height | 3860.0 × 1980.0 × 2690.0 |
| Weight | 6910 kg |
| Width | 2090 mm |
| CNC | CD 2000. |
